Ticket: DEPLOYBOT-ROLLOUT — Needs sign-off

The Heraldly chat bot now posts deploy status for all Coppermill services, replacing the old dashboard pings. Message formatting, failure alerts, and rollback notices have passed staging checks. Before enabling in the production channel, release management sign-off is required. Please review the attached test transcript and confirm with the approver named below.

approver of bajeg-bajef = Istion Pelys Holax Wenox

Visitors and new starters at the Calderwick site are assigned a locker in the changing rooms on the ground floor, adjacent to the east stairwell. Lockers are allocated by the facilities team on your first morning and must be emptied before any absence longer than five working days. Personal padlocks are not permitted. To enter the changing rooms, use the access code provided below.

door code, yagap-bahof: bdg-O-05

## Data Stores — FD Leak Hunt

Context for review: the descriptor leak in Harkness worker pools only reproduces against the metrics store, not the fixtures. Leak counts are logged to the `fd_audit` table every sweep. Check the audit rows before and after the patched pool is exercised. Query the metrics store using the connection string below.

warehouse DSN: mssql://rusdor_svc:0FSWCn9@db-951a.paliqforge.local:5432/ulawyn